Mounting the Base Unit on a Wall

Standard wall plate mounting

This phone can be mounted on any standard wall plate.

1)Remove the wall mount adapter from the base and snap it into the notches on the bottom of the base.

2)Plug the AC adapter to the DC IN 9V jack.

CAUTION: To avoid risk of fire and shock, only use the Uniden AD-314 AC adapter.

3)Route the AC adapter cord inside the molded wiring channel as shown.

4)Plug the AC adapter into a standard 120V AC wall outlet.

5)Plug the telephone line cord into the phone jack.

6)Route the telephone line cord inside the molded wiring channel as shown.

7)Plug the telephone line cord into the telephone outlet.

8)Align the mounting slots on the base with the mounting posts on the wall. Then push in and down until he phone is firmly seated.

9)On the base unit, pull the corded handset retainer out of the slot. Rotate it clockwise 180 degrees.

10)Flip the retainer from front to back. Slide it back into the slot so that the lip of the retainer is up and the oval is down. The retainer holds the corded handset in place.
